Software Development Services : In a digital-first economy, businesses require powerful, flexible, and secure software systems to stay competitive. Off-the-shelf solutions often fail to meet specific operational requirements. At Vihaainfosoft, we provide professional software development services tailored to your business objectives, workflows, and scalability needs.

Our software solutions are engineered for performance, security, and long-term growth. Whether you need enterprise software, web-based applications, or cloud platforms, our development approach ensures measurable business impact.


What Are Software Development Services?

Software development services involve designing, building, testing, and maintaining custom applications or systems tailored to a company’s unique requirements.

Professional software development services typically include:

  • Custom software development

  • Web application development

  • Enterprise software solutions

  • SaaS platform development

  • API development & integration

  • Software modernization

  • Maintenance and support

The goal is to create scalable digital solutions that optimize processes and improve productivity.


Why Custom Software Development Is Important

Many businesses rely on generic software that does not align with their operations. Custom software development services provide:

  • Tailored functionality

  • Process automation

  • Higher efficiency

  • Improved data management

  • Competitive advantage

  • Scalability for future growth

When software aligns with business strategy, operational performance improves significantly.


Our Comprehensive Software Development Services

At Vihaainfosoft, we deliver end-to-end software solutions.


1. Custom Software Development

We design and build fully customized software applications based on your specific requirements.

Our Custom Development Covers:

  • Business workflow automation

  • Custom dashboards and reporting tools

  • Internal management systems

  • Industry-specific software

Each solution is built to match your operational model.


2. Web Application Development

Web application development and UI UX design process
Web application development and UI UX design process

Web applications allow businesses to operate efficiently from any location.

We develop:

  • Secure web portals

  • Admin management systems

  • SaaS-based web apps

  • Multi-user platforms

  • Customer-facing applications

Our web applications are responsive, secure, and optimized for performance.


3. Enterprise Software Development

Custom software architecture and backend development process
Custom software architecture and backend development process

Enterprise software supports large-scale business operations.

Our enterprise solutions include:

  • ERP systems

  • CRM integrations

  • HR management systems

  • Inventory management software

  • Accounting software

Enterprise systems are designed to improve operational transparency and scalability.


4. SaaS Application Development

Software as a Service (SaaS) platforms require scalable cloud architecture.

We build:

  • Multi-tenant SaaS platforms

  • Subscription management systems

  • Secure authentication systems

  • Cloud-native applications

Our SaaS development services focus on security, uptime, and performance.


5. API Development & Integration

API integration connecting multiple enterprise systems
API integration connecting multiple enterprise systems

Modern software ecosystems require seamless integration between platforms.

We develop and integrate:

  • RESTful APIs

  • Third-party service integrations

  • Payment gateway integrations

  • CRM and ERP integrations

APIs improve automation and data flow efficiency.


6. Software Maintenance & Support

Software development does not end at deployment.

Our maintenance services include:

  • Performance monitoring

  • Bug fixing

  • Feature upgrades

  • Security updates

  • Scalability improvements

Ongoing support ensures long-term system stability.


Our Software Development Process

We follow a structured and transparent development methodology.


Step 1: Requirement Analysis

We conduct detailed discussions to understand:

  • Business objectives

  • Operational challenges

  • Technical requirements

  • Budget constraints

This phase ensures clarity and alignment.


Step 2: Planning & Architecture Design

We create:

  • System architecture diagrams

  • Database structures

  • Workflow mapping

  • Technology stack selection

Proper planning reduces development risks.


Step 3: UI/UX Design

User experience directly impacts adoption rates.

We design:

  • Intuitive interfaces

  • Responsive layouts

  • User-friendly dashboards

  • Seamless navigation systems

A strong UI/UX increases productivity and customer satisfaction.


Step 4: Agile Development

We follow agile methodology to ensure flexibility and continuous improvement.

  • Sprint-based development

  • Regular feedback cycles

  • Transparent progress tracking

Agile development improves speed and quality.


Step 5: Testing & Quality Assurance

Quality assurance is critical.

We perform:

  • Functional testing

  • Performance testing

  • Security testing

  • Cross-platform testing

Every solution is thoroughly tested before deployment.


Step 6: Deployment & Optimization

After testing, we deploy the software in live environments.

We also optimize:

  • Performance

  • Load capacity

  • Security configurations

Deployment is followed by continuous monitoring.


Technologies We Work With

Our software development services utilize modern technologies.

Front-End Technologies:

  • React

  • Angular

  • Vue.js

Back-End Technologies:

  • Node.js

  • PHP

  • Python

  • .NET

Databases:

  • MySQL

  • PostgreSQL

  • MongoDB

Cloud Platforms:

  • AWS

  • Google Cloud

  • Microsoft Azure

Technology selection depends on project requirements and scalability goals.


Benefits of Choosing Vihaainfosoft for Software Development Services

✔ Customized Solutions

We build software that aligns with your business model.

✔ Scalable Architecture

Our systems grow with your business.

✔ Secure Development Practices

Data protection and compliance are prioritized.

✔ Transparent Communication

Regular updates and milestone reporting.

✔ Post-Launch Support

We ensure continuous improvement.


Industries We Serve

Our software development services support:

  • IT & Technology Companies

  • Healthcare Institutions

  • Financial Services

  • E-commerce Businesses

  • Education Sector

  • Real Estate Firms

  • Startups & Enterprises

Every industry has unique technical challenges, and we adapt accordingly.


Custom Software vs Off-the-Shelf Software

Custom Software Off-the-Shelf Software
Tailored to your needs Generic functionality
Scalable Limited customization
Higher long-term ROI Recurring licensing costs
Competitive advantage Common to competitors

Custom software development services provide long-term business value.


Security in Software Development

Security is integrated into every stage of development.

We implement:

  • Secure coding practices

  • Data encryption

  • Role-based access control

  • Regular security audits

  • Compliance standards

Data protection builds trust and reduces operational risk.


How Long Does Software Development Take?

Development timelines depend on complexity.

  • Small applications: 1–3 months

  • Medium-scale systems: 3–6 months

  • Enterprise software: 6–12 months

We provide clear project timelines and milestone tracking.


Frequently Asked Questions

What is included in software development services?

Software development services include requirement analysis, design, coding, testing, deployment, and maintenance.

Is custom software development expensive?

Initial investment may be higher, but long-term ROI and operational efficiency justify the cost.

Do you provide post-launch support?

Yes, we offer ongoing maintenance and performance optimization services.


Transform Your Business with Custom Software Solutions

Technology drives business success. Investing in professional software development services ensures operational efficiency, scalability, and competitive advantage.

At Vihaainfosoft, we build secure, scalable, and performance-driven software tailored to your growth goals.


Ready to build a powerful custom software solution?

👉 Contact Vihaainfosoft today for a consultation and project roadmap.